Abstract
An uninterruptible power supply system comprising a source of a utility power signal, a source of hydrogen, a fuel cell stack, first and second input circuits, an output circuit, and a control circuit. The fuel cell stack converts the hydrogen into a fuel cell output signal. The first input circuit is operatively connected to the utility power signal and outputs a first AC input signal based on the utility power signal. The second input circuit operatively is connected to the fuel cell output signal and generates a second AC input signal based on the fuel cell output signal. The output circuit is operatively connected to the first and second input circuits and outputs at least one output signal based on one of the first and second AC input signals. The control circuit operatively is connected to the fuel cell stack, the first input circuit, the second input circuit. The output circuit controls whether the output signal is generated based on the utility power signal or hydrogen.
